It’s been awhile since we’ve shared a fanfiction and we’ve decided that needs to be remedied. The title behind these posts may have changed, but the purpose remains the same. We’re sharing a Lucifer story, posted on Archive of our Own, which revolves around Lucifer and an original character. Though, you may still like it even if you ship Lucifer and Chloe. Below is the first chapter of CapsGirl0427’s story titled ‘Dancing with the Devil’. To read the rest, click here. Our only warning is that some scenes take on a more mature theme.
